Italian confectioner Ferrero, known for brands like Nutella and Kinder, is buying the century-old U.S. cereal company WK Kellogg in an effort to expand its North American sales.
Ferrero will buy Kellogg for $23 per share in cash for a total of about $3.1 billion. The deal has been approved by Kellogg’s board of directors, though it still needs to be approved by shareholders ...
